What is the ISO 62366 Standard?
ISO 62366 is an international standard that focuses on the usability engineering process for medical devices. It outlines the requirements for the design, labeling, and instructions for use of medical devices to ensure that they are safe, effective, and easy to use for both healthcare professionals and patients. The standard covers all aspects of the user interface, including design, labeling, and instructions for use, with the goal of reducing the risk of human error and improving patient safety.
The Importance of Usability in Medical Device Design
Usability is a critical factor in medical device design. The goal of usability engineering is to reduce the risk of human error and improve patient safety by ensuring that medical devices are designed to be user-friendly and intuitive. Medical devices that are easy to use and understand can help healthcare professionals to provide accurate and effective care to their patients.
Key Requirements of ISO 62366
ISO 62366 Standard has several key requirements that medical device manufacturers must comply with. These requirements include:
* Design: Medical devices must be designed to minimize the risk of human error. This includes ensuring that medical devices are user-friendly, intuitive, and easy to use.
* Labeling: Medical devices must be labeled in a way that is easy for healthcare professionals and patients to understand.
* Instructions for use: Medical devices must include instructions for use that are easy for healthcare professionals and patients to follow.
* User interface: Medical devices must have a user interface that is intuitive and easy to use.
* Safety and effectiveness: Medical devices must be safe and effective for use in appropriate healthcare settings.
